If you move out of state without filing for divorce, the father may be able to compel your and/or the child's return.
The father of the children can of course file for custody and get a court order from the court that orders her to return to the state with the children.
So she just takes the risk of possible loss of custody if she did not do that or the trouble of moving back if so ordered. So they have to decide the risk.
